rear-positioned house on large block | 1057sqm with pool | quiet court in Frankston | low 3% building coverage offers rare expansion potential This property’s competitive advantage is its land-to-building ratio. At only 3% coverage on 1,057 square metres, the house sits on a block nearly three times the size of the front unit, yet the building footprint is minimal. That configuration is rare in a suburban court setting and gives a buyer genuine optionality: extend the existing dwelling, add a studio or granny flat, or simply enjoy the private rear position with an in-ground pool and no overlooking neighbours. The property suits a buyer who values space and future flexibility over a turnkey interior, particularly families or downsizers wanting room to adapt without moving. The quiet court location and absence of bushfire, flood, or heritage overlays further strengthen the case for long-term hold. The primary risk is the building itself. At 36 square metres of internal area and built in 1978, the house is small by modern standards and may require significant updating to meet contemporary expectations. A buyer should budget for renovation or extension costs, and verify whether council approvals for additional dwelling or subdivision are feasible given the lot size and zoning. The rental yield is modest relative to the purchase price, so this property is better suited to an owner-occupier who will add value over time than to a pure investor seeking immediate cash flow. The front unit’s pending sale may also influence perceived market value, so careful comparison is warranted.
